Based on various rumors, it sounds like this is a possible outcome:

1.  Cleveland wants Wiggins or Embiid...let's assume they draft WIGGINS
2.  Milwaukee wants Parker or Exum...let's assume they draft PARKER
3.  Philly wants Wiggins or Exum, and is lukewarm on Embiid...let's assume they draft EXUM
4.  Magic supposedly want a PG.  If they want Marcus Smart, he should be available at 6 with a trade down and likely not available at 10.  They could try to trade up from 10 a bit, but who knows 5 and down who is going to take who.  If Smart is who they covet, perhaps they deal 4 to us for 6 and a future protected pick, etc (or something else).  OR perhaps they just take SMART.
5.  Utah supposedly is most willing to move up and down, and has some big men.  Again, a trade opportunity here.

Of course, the other day Milwaukee supposedly wanted Embiid.  But even then, if the top 3 is Wiggins, Embiid, Exum, and Orlando really wants a PG, perhaps we could move up for Parker.

Point being...I don't think we are necessarily OUT of the Parker or Embiid sweepstakes yet, and I am sure if there is a move to be made and we actually want one of those guys, Danny will find a way.
